The Strategic Imperative for OEM ERP Monetization
In the evolving landscape of retail technology, Original Equipment Manufacturer (OEM) partnerships have become a critical growth vector for ERP vendors and platform providers. Unlike traditional direct sales, OEM ERP monetization frameworks allow retail platforms to embed enterprise-grade ERP capabilities directly into their offerings, creating a seamless value proposition for end-users. This approach shifts the focus from selling software licenses to delivering integrated business outcomes, where the ERP engine operates invisibly behind the platform's user interface.
For ERP vendors, this model expands market reach without the overhead of direct customer acquisition. For retail platforms, it provides the operational backbone necessary to manage complex supply chains, inventory, and financials without building these systems from scratch. However, the success of these alliances hinges on a robust monetization framework that aligns incentives, defines clear governance, and ensures technical scalability. Without a structured approach, these partnerships can suffer from misaligned commercial interests, technical debt, and operational bottlenecks.
Core Revenue Models for OEM Alliances
Defining the revenue model is the first step in establishing a sustainable OEM ERP partnership. The most common structures include per-user licensing, transaction-based fees, and platform subscription bundles. Per-user licensing is straightforward but may not scale effectively if the retail platform's user base fluctuates significantly. Transaction-based fees, where the ERP vendor earns a percentage of processed transactions, aligns revenue with customer success but requires robust tracking and reconciliation mechanisms.
Platform subscription bundles are increasingly popular, where the retail platform includes ERP capabilities in its overall subscription fee. In this model, the ERP vendor receives a fixed or tiered payment from the platform provider, shifting the risk of customer churn to the platform. This model requires careful negotiation to ensure the ERP vendor is compensated for the value delivered, particularly if the platform offers extensive customization or additional services. Hybrid models, combining base subscriptions with usage-based fees, offer flexibility and can be tailored to the specific needs of the retail segment.
Governance Structures and Decision Rights
Effective governance is the backbone of any successful OEM ERP alliance. A joint governance board, comprising senior executives from both the ERP vendor and the retail platform, should oversee strategic direction, commercial performance, and technical roadmap alignment. This board meets quarterly to review key performance indicators, address escalations, and approve major changes to the partnership scope.
Below the strategic board, an operational committee should manage day-to-day coordination. This group includes product managers, engineering leads, and customer success representatives from both parties. Their role is to ensure that technical roadmaps are aligned, integration issues are resolved promptly, and customer feedback is incorporated into product development. Clear decision rights must be defined for each level, with escalation paths for unresolved issues. This structure ensures that both parties have visibility into the partnership's health and can act swiftly to address challenges.
Technical Integration and Architecture
The technical architecture of an OEM ERP integration must be designed for scalability, security, and maintainability. A multi-tenant architecture is essential to support multiple retail customers within a single platform instance. This requires robust data isolation mechanisms to ensure that customer data remains secure and compliant with regulatory requirements. APIs serve as the primary interface between the retail platform and the ERP engine, enabling real-time data exchange for inventory, orders, and financials.
REST APIs are commonly used for their simplicity and widespread support, while GraphQL can be employed for more complex data queries that require flexibility. Webhooks can be used for event-driven notifications, such as order status changes or inventory alerts. Middleware or an Integration Platform as a Service (iPaaS) may be necessary to handle complex data transformations and orchestrate workflows between the ERP and other enterprise systems, such as CRM or supply chain management tools. The architecture must also include robust monitoring and observability tools to track performance, identify bottlenecks, and ensure system reliability.
Security, Compliance, and Data Protection
Security is a paramount concern in OEM ERP alliances, particularly in the retail sector where customer data is highly sensitive. Identity and Access Management (IAM) systems must be integrated to ensure that only authorized users can access specific ERP functions. Least privilege principles should be applied to limit access to only what is necessary for each role. Segregation of duties is critical to prevent fraud and ensure compliance with financial regulations.
Data encryption, both in transit and at rest, is mandatory to protect sensitive information. Audit trails must be maintained to track all changes to data and system configurations, providing a clear history for compliance and forensic purposes. Compliance with data protection regulations, such as GDPR or CCPA, must be addressed in the partnership agreement, with clear responsibilities for data handling and breach notification. Regular security audits and penetration testing should be conducted to identify and mitigate vulnerabilities.
Implementation and Delivery Models
The implementation model for OEM ERP deployments can vary depending on the complexity of the integration and the capabilities of the partner teams. Customer-led implementation, where the retail platform's internal team manages the deployment, offers greater control but requires significant technical expertise. Partner-led implementation, where a system integrator or managed service provider handles the deployment, can accelerate time-to-value but may introduce additional costs and coordination challenges.
Co-delivery models, where both the ERP vendor and the retail platform collaborate on the implementation, are often the most effective for complex integrations. This approach leverages the ERP vendor's product expertise and the platform's customer knowledge to ensure a smooth deployment. Clear roles and responsibilities must be defined for each phase of the implementation, from discovery and requirements gathering to configuration, testing, and go-live. Post-go-live support and optimization are also critical to ensure long-term success and customer satisfaction.
Risk Management and Quality Assurance
Risk management is an ongoing process in OEM ERP alliances. Key risks include technical integration failures, data security breaches, commercial misalignment, and customer churn. A risk register should be maintained to identify, assess, and mitigate these risks. Regular risk reviews should be conducted as part of the governance process, with clear action plans for high-priority risks.
Quality assurance is essential to ensure that the ERP integration meets the required standards. Automated testing, including unit, integration, and end-to-end tests, should be implemented to catch defects early in the development cycle. User acceptance testing (UAT) should be conducted with a representative group of retail customers to validate that the system meets their needs. Release management processes should be in place to ensure that updates and patches are deployed safely and without disruption to customer operations.
Scalability and Performance Optimization
As the retail platform grows, the ERP integration must scale to accommodate increased transaction volumes and user counts. Cloud-native architectures, leveraging containerization and orchestration tools like Kubernetes, can provide the elasticity needed to handle peak loads. Database optimization, including indexing and query tuning, is critical to maintain performance as data volumes grow. Caching mechanisms, such as Redis, can be used to reduce database load and improve response times for frequently accessed data.
Performance monitoring and observability tools should be used to track key metrics, such as response times, error rates, and resource utilization. Alerts should be configured to notify the operations team of any anomalies, enabling proactive intervention before issues impact customers. Regular performance reviews should be conducted to identify bottlenecks and optimize the system for future growth. This proactive approach to scalability ensures that the ERP integration can support the retail platform's long-term business objectives.
Commercial Considerations and Contractual Terms
The commercial terms of an OEM ERP alliance must be clearly defined to avoid disputes and ensure mutual benefit. Key terms include revenue sharing percentages, payment schedules, and minimum volume commitments. Service level agreements (SLAs) should specify the expected uptime, response times, and support levels, with penalties for non-compliance. Intellectual property rights must be clearly defined, particularly for any customizations or integrations developed during the partnership.
Exit clauses should be included to provide a clear path for either party to terminate the partnership if necessary. These clauses should address data migration, customer notification, and any outstanding financial obligations. Regular commercial reviews should be conducted to assess the partnership's performance and adjust terms if necessary. This flexibility ensures that the partnership remains aligned with the evolving needs of both parties and the market.
